I have disabled some programs from starting in my msconfig, and the booting time is much quicker, but everytime i boot up a dialogue box pops us saying something on the lines of "your startup has been modified or changed with msconfig, causing msconfig to load everytime windows starts"
Can anyone provide me with a solution, so that my bootup settings stay the same, but the msconfig doesnt load up.

set every thing back the way it was with MSCONFIG

and use this instead





Startup Control Panel

Startup Control Panel is a nifty control panel applet that allows you to easily configure which programs run when your computer starts. It's simple to use and, like all my programs, it's very small and won't burden your system. A valuable tool for system administrators!
Startup Control Panel is compatible with all modern versions of Windows through Windows XP. Windows Vista, after all these years, finally has a very good startup manager built-in; go to Control Panel > Performance Information and Tools, and then click on Manage Startup Programs on the left.
